Someone should make a Samsung keys cafe( keyboard customiser) app version for iOS

Not a ‘find me a keyboard’ post, but just a suggestion that I think someone should make a Samsung keys cafe app for iOS

Keys cafe is essentially a keyboard customiser that Samsung makes. Want a number row? Add it in. What the space bar wider or narrower? Do that. Want a question mark symbol somewhere random? Do it. Resize the whole keyboard to suit your typing style. Easy. Add, remove or move any key. Possible. Resize individual keys. Also possible. It’s basically allowing you to diy your keyboard layout based on how you type, like and don’t like.
